widget/cocoa/TextInputHandler.mm
48788ac2e02f29d8b0e39dcdb8c95ac30e8b7657
created 2013-07-25 15:09 +0900
pushed 2013-07-25 16:05 +0000
Masayuki Nakano Masayuki Nakano - Bug 501496 part.3 Don't dispatch keypress events if defaultPrevent() of the keydown event is called on Cocoa r=smaug+smichaud
2c202f6a042fae2d14cce9790c2ceeecea9e7661
created 2013-07-13 11:53 +0900
pushed 2013-07-15 19:11 +0000
Masayuki Nakano Masayuki Nakano - Bug 810225 part.4 Replace NSInputManager in IMEInputHandler::KillIMEComposition() with NSTextInputContext r=smichaund
91069e8f9c32271af01d1ab01620a30c64271662
created 2013-07-13 11:53 +0900
pushed 2013-07-15 19:11 +0000
Masayuki Nakano Masayuki Nakano - Bug 810225 part.3 Replace NSInputManager in IMEInputHandler::DiscardIMEComposition() with NSTextInputContext r=smichaund
b20a4c478489f8376566f42faf13200cd020eb67
created 2013-07-13 11:53 +0900
pushed 2013-07-15 19:11 +0000
Masayuki Nakano Masayuki Nakano - Bug 810225 part.2 Replace the hack for ::TSMGetActiveDocument() with NSTextInputContext r=smichaund
29d5168b991f974f2cd41bb1641736a29bd830f5
created 2013-07-13 11:53 +0900
pushed 2013-07-15 19:11 +0000
Masayuki Nakano Masayuki Nakano - Bug 810225 part.1 Replace NSInputManager in PR_LOG() with NSTextInputContext r=smichaund
a00e830672350da59cfeab683c9aa61c09997bce
created 2013-07-10 09:12 -0500
pushed 2013-07-12 01:58 +0000
J. Ryan Stinnett J. Ryan Stinnett - Bug 282097 - Part 7: Simulate native events for testing. r=masayuki
4bb128a0bcef94e48ca9dc5ab80f83a58b8f7de9
created 2013-07-10 09:08 -0500
pushed 2013-07-12 01:58 +0000
J. Ryan Stinnett J. Ryan Stinnett - Bug 282097 - Part 4: Create NativeKeyBindings for Cocoa. r=masayuki, r=smichaud
86a041d63d650211bd53a108113408e041c87907
created 2013-07-11 16:46 +0900
pushed 2013-07-12 01:58 +0000
Masayuki Nakano Masayuki Nakano - Bug 875674 part.8 Notify IME of focus change in Gecko for resetting IME stored window level r=smichaud
2323d0f079f9c046257c4db81e2a566861e5b32e
created 2013-07-11 16:46 +0900
pushed 2013-07-12 01:58 +0000
Masayuki Nakano Masayuki Nakano - Bug 875674 part.7 Implement setMarkedText:selectedRange:replacementRange: of NSTextInputClient r=smichaud
71c683c5f7d769dba562d42b817d62f22925637c
created 2013-07-11 16:46 +0900
pushed 2013-07-12 01:58 +0000
Masayuki Nakano Masayuki Nakano - Bug 875674 part.6 Implement insertText:replacementRange: of NSTextInputClient r=smichaud
61959adde7611ed662cefdb79881e3c24dd78387
created 2013-07-11 16:46 +0900
pushed 2013-07-12 01:58 +0000
Masayuki Nakano Masayuki Nakano - Bug 875674 part.5 Implement attributedSubstringForProposedRange:actualRange: of NSTextInputClient r=roc+smichaud
9fd6977113ae1cf030c334dda60232bfaf19976e
created 2013-07-11 16:46 +0900
pushed 2013-07-12 01:58 +0000
Masayuki Nakano Masayuki Nakano - Bug 875674 part.4 Implement firstRectForCharacterRange:actualRange: of NSTextInputClient r=roc+smichaud
4b4ecd2243660f3314dc6f2652e74ced565142d3
created 2013-07-11 16:46 +0900
pushed 2013-07-12 01:58 +0000
Masayuki Nakano Masayuki Nakano - Bug 875674 part.3 Implement windowLevel of NSTextInputClient r=smichaud
680e0bd7f71f918e98d14540646d3ad9a9d62ff1
created 2013-07-11 16:46 +0900
pushed 2013-07-12 01:58 +0000
Masayuki Nakano Masayuki Nakano - Bug 875674 part.2 Cache selection for improving the performance r=smichaud
b6e3eb662e4e42cf51472a7cc0fbf0af9f44e885
created 2013-05-25 01:27 +0900
pushed 2013-05-26 13:22 +0000
Masayuki Nakano Masayuki Nakano - Bug 807893 part.2 Cocoa widget should manage secure input mode with input context at changing the context and changing focus r=smichaud
e4b70c31bc9e19ee0f1ea616c61111ab874c9c95
created 2013-04-24 12:49 +0900
pushed 2013-04-25 12:41 +0000
Masayuki Nakano Masayuki Nakano - Bug 842927 part.5 Implement D3E KeyboardEvent.key on Cocoa r=smaug+smichaud
0831c937f066b2eb9631d99b06afb6cfc5169002
created 2013-01-11 12:30 +0900
pushed 2013-01-12 05:36 +0000
Masayuki Nakano Masayuki Nakano - Bug 821329 Set charCode of keypress event when TextInputHandler::InsertText() is called without native key event r=smichaud
53accd955c2ba8ea558815a1b3dcb164416daf41
created 2012-12-21 17:31 +0900
pushed 2012-12-23 13:58 +0000
Masayuki Nakano Masayuki Nakano - Bug 815383 Handle shift, control, option and meta flags in NSFlagsChanged event handler even if some applications send it with device dependent flags but without proper keyCode r=smichaud
d5dcc27a64d19fa48008bba6bff79c66c6d5c6a9
created 2012-12-16 10:26 +0900
pushed 2012-12-19 08:05 +0000
Masayuki Nakano Masayuki Nakano - Bug 813445 part.5 Remove NS_EVENT_FLAG_NO_DEFAULT and NS_EVENT_FLAG_NO_DEFAULT_CALLED_IN_CONTENT r=smaug
4a4fd71c32521e09e1b8ae70bc6840becd631873
created 2012-10-31 08:22 +0900
pushed 2012-11-01 07:35 +0000
Masayuki Nakano Masayuki Nakano - Bug 805357 part.1 nsIMEStateManager should always call nsIWidget::OnIMEFocusChange(false) when our editor loses focus r=smaug
05e44f47d1bf152709d1d72f73664feeec7e38e4
created 2012-10-25 14:44 -0400
pushed 2012-10-27 02:40 +0000
Ehsan Akhgari Ehsan Akhgari - Bug 579517 follow-up: Remove NSPR types that crept in
6f9d1e6b22c0189e842b99855159f43493943cf1
created 2012-10-25 12:32 -0400
pushed 2012-10-27 02:40 +0000
Ehsan Akhgari Ehsan Akhgari - Backed out 2 changesets (bug 579517)
86ccf7c918ce6392d8d5eb20acb05fdcf6936c11
created 2012-10-25 11:48 -0400
pushed 2012-10-27 02:40 +0000
Ehsan Akhgari Ehsan Akhgari - Code hygiene: don't use PR_TRUE and PR_FALSE, and use stdint types instead of PRInt types (no bug really, but you could say bug 579517)
e73ea50909dca257c129b6db6591e18f6f87908f
created 2012-10-19 10:17 +0900
pushed 2012-10-20 05:15 +0000
Masayuki Nakano Masayuki Nakano - Bug 786956 Rewrite FSFlagsChanged handler r=smichaud
a10052ea8e7263e3c9d689e3e98de54964dd5ad9
created 2012-10-16 10:43 +0900
pushed 2012-10-20 05:15 +0000
Masayuki Nakano Masayuki Nakano - Bug 795230 Use ASCII capable keyboard layout for computing charCode if current input source is an IME mode and open r=smichaud
faa749453ea4da994daf9bd3630bb3d229c4d691
created 2012-10-15 08:38 -0400
pushed 2012-10-20 05:15 +0000
Josh Aas Josh Aas - Bug 598397: Remove support for Carbon NPAPI. r=smichaud
019cfa68404af477e6035d5cbb286c7406e8660a
created 2012-10-10 19:09 +0100
pushed 2012-10-13 21:20 +0000
Jonathan Kew Jonathan Kew - bug 799900 - [HiDPI] account for device-pixel scaling for IME window position. r=smichaud
ae68e6c539a21a7a2b65e33b1e9d7fd3401812a1
created 2012-09-05 16:18 -0700
pushed 2012-09-13 10:46 +0000
David Anderson David Anderson - Merge from mozilla-central.
c4f83d9d8243f3f853a5356188164a5fddee2b5a
created 2012-08-22 16:09 -0700
pushed 2012-09-13 10:46 +0000
David Anderson David Anderson - Merge from mozilla-central.
08187a7ea8974548382f5d7775df8171a4ec6449
created 2012-07-30 13:15 -0700
pushed 2012-09-13 10:46 +0000
David Anderson David Anderson - Merge from mozilla-central.
50e28df7ff8fa9d0fcbac8ade290afce87a601ed
created 2012-07-24 16:32 -0700
pushed 2012-09-13 10:46 +0000
David Anderson David Anderson - Merge from mozilla-central.
b82fb4d04f6025775b8faffb0a9cd46cb7e222bf
created 2012-07-23 12:37 -0700
pushed 2012-09-13 10:46 +0000
David Anderson David Anderson - Merge from mozilla-central.
7aa128dbd1a9e5b9272376aa9a1f4aa23afd8787
created 2012-07-10 19:45 -0700
pushed 2012-09-13 10:46 +0000
David Anderson David Anderson - Merge from mozilla-central.
474d3f16960fb6bc790f0f46b77d0248424b84ef
created 2012-05-31 17:17 -0700
pushed 2012-09-13 10:46 +0000
Sean Stangl Sean Stangl - Merge m-c onto Ionmonkey.
80e4ab0d24bc64ceaa7693ab5def36faffde7a40
created 2012-05-21 14:40 -0700
pushed 2012-09-13 10:46 +0000
David Anderson David Anderson - Merge from mozilla-central.
080fe4327259783bf01cd24cc561cbc21e61d959
created 2012-05-04 19:16 -0700
pushed 2012-09-13 10:46 +0000
David Anderson David Anderson - Merge from mozilla-central.
44911569fb04d891073656cac1f794495723f573
created 2012-04-30 12:53 -0700
pushed 2012-09-13 10:46 +0000
David Anderson David Anderson - Merge from mozilla-central.
c95bd17c4ae77baa34324a9e790b5684254830eb
created 2012-03-30 18:40 -0700
pushed 2012-09-13 10:46 +0000
David Anderson David Anderson - Merge from mozilla-central.
6276fe64003543e107ade90054f382c550ef5d66
created 2012-01-05 12:10 -0800| base
pushed 2012-09-13 10:46 +0000
David Anderson David Anderson - Merge from mozilla-central.
a962ec74a5264570ff52a6452e28bd6dd29521c8
created 2012-08-30 21:22 -0700
pushed 2012-09-03 10:27 +0000
Phil Ringnalda Phil Ringnalda - Bug 784783 followup, remove the stray ) which is causing build bustage
0fcec4cafd15b2bf9186c311cb4f77d48a457de3
created 2012-08-31 12:55 +0900
pushed 2012-09-03 10:27 +0000
Masayuki Nakano Masayuki Nakano - Bug 784783 Don't access [NSEvent characters] if the event type is neither NSKeyDown nor NSKeyUp r=smichaud
a16372ce30b5f6b747246b01fcd215a4bf3b6342
created 2012-08-22 11:56 -0400
pushed 2012-08-23 05:16 +0000
Ehsan Akhgari Ehsan Akhgari - Bug 579517 - Part 1: Automated conversion of NSPR numeric types to stdint types in Gecko; r=bsmedberg
b5c4b792f3f2a047e3517472d72842a76afb77cd
created 2012-07-30 17:20 +0300
pushed 2012-07-31 14:39 +0000
Aryeh Gregor Aryeh Gregor - Bug 777292 part 2 - Change all nsnull to nullptr
0a5b58d92843dcd90afe1e7e17f596c6957c15ca
created 2012-07-20 14:16 +0300
pushed 2012-07-24 10:33 +0000
Aryeh Gregor Aryeh Gregor - Bug 626472 part 1 - Define nsnull as nullptr where available; r=ehsan
440ac3414c64a655d9c5bf4e6cdd2fdf9c22403e
created 2012-07-21 08:24 +0900
pushed 2012-07-21 10:50 +0000
Masayuki Nakano Masayuki Nakano - Bug 775414 InitKeyEvent() should decide input string instead of InitKeyPressEvent() r=smichaud
0f516031218f412e4edde7ef545fc70059a41f00
created 2012-07-04 14:59 +0900
pushed 2012-07-04 21:28 +0000
Masayuki Nakano Masayuki Nakano - Bug 764285 part.2 Use naming rules of virtual keycodes in SDK for defining undefined keycode r=smichaud
83f49d543833c18b9a2c8506431eec1583bc57d9
created 2012-07-04 14:59 +0900
pushed 2012-07-04 21:28 +0000
Masayuki Nakano Masayuki Nakano - Bug 764285 part.1 Use virtual keycodes defined in SDK r=smichaud
1543ca5ec175c746a3287138e220e98b5f03fb5a
created 2012-05-31 10:25 +0900
pushed 2012-05-31 18:49 +0000
Masayuki Nakano Masayuki Nakano - Bug 759524 Fix the condition of NS_ASSERTION in TISInputSourceWrapper::InitKeyPressEvent() r=smichaud
85e529ae09f9f25790b742fae2820c95294cbd67
created 2012-05-26 11:35 +0900
pushed 2012-05-26 17:15 +0000
Masayuki Nakano Masayuki Nakano - Bug 758420 Use specified character by inserText rather than the first character of current key event for charCode r=smichaud
f4157e8c410708d76703f19e4dfb61859bfe32d8
created 2012-05-21 12:12 +0100
pushed 2012-05-21 12:35 +0000
Gervase Markham Gervase Markham - Bug 716478 - update licence to MPL 2.
5c5211cd5a3909f4426ee732f93b26e91a292b5a
created 2012-05-17 16:04 +0900
pushed 2012-05-21 06:50 +0000
Masayuki Nakano Masayuki Nakano - Bug 677252 part.2 Add Eisu keycode for Japanese keyboard layout of Mac r=smichaud, sr=smaug
29e512736f30b0aef384e7c3dc7bee0ca326b9fa
created 2012-05-17 16:04 +0900
pushed 2012-05-21 06:50 +0000
Masayuki Nakano Masayuki Nakano - Bug 677252 part.1 Reimplement keycode computation in cocoa widget r=smaug+smichaud
27b17363e5bac3a9e30fef16e1d7bb04fa4604e9
created 2012-05-03 17:35 +0900
pushed 2012-05-04 14:23 +0000
Masayuki Nakano Masayuki Nakano - Bug 166240 part.4 Add support KeyboardEvent.location on Cocoa r=smichaud
f38b80d2743dba65faaf7514fedfde2d86dce521
created 2012-04-25 12:00 +0900
pushed 2012-04-27 12:45 +0000
Masayuki Nakano Masayuki Nakano - Bug 630811 part.6 Support new modifiers on all events derived from nsInputEvent on Cocoa r=smichaud
31f1d027a49f239848c4406f1c0cd57552228832
created 2012-03-30 12:37 +0900
pushed 2012-03-30 16:31 +0000
Masayuki Nakano Masayuki Nakano - Bug 735648 Append command char and shifted commanded char when command key is pressed on Dvorak-QWERTY r=smichaud+karlt
e57e271bf32838bd8c9d7b96d96409e445970fee
created 2012-01-03 22:09 -0500| base
pushed 2012-01-05 09:22 +0000
Brian R. Bondy Brian R. Bondy - Bug 679226 - Fold widget/src into widget. r=roc
less more (0) tip